How are merlot and fruit preserves different?
- Fruit preserves have more copper and vitamin C than merlot.
- Merlot contains 3 times more magnesium than fruit preserves. While merlot contains 12mg of magnesium, fruit preserves contain only 4mg.
- Merlot has less sugar.
- Merlot has a lower glycemic index (15) than fruit preserves (51).
Alcoholic Beverage, wine, table, red, Merlot and Jams and preserves are the varieties used in this article.
